The UCHC announced its 2025-26 Men’s Championship All-Tournament Team following the league’s title game on Saturday, March 7. Junior forward Nicholas Rogers of top-seed Utica University was named the UCHC Tournament Most Valuable Player after helping lead the Pioneers to their fourth league title in the last five seasons and sixth UCHC crown overall.
Rogers scored the game-winning goal with 5:46 left in regulation on a sensational individual effort that broke a 1-1 tie and catapaulted Utica to the 4-1 title game over No. 2 seed SUNY Geneseo. Rogers picked up a loose puck in the neutral zone, skated into the Geneseo end of the ice with a full head of steam, around a defender and then darted to the outside, faking a shot before scoring on a wrap-around.
Utica goaltender Kyle Curtin, along with defenseman Alex German and forwards John Gutt and Aiden Hughes earned All-Tournament Team honors. Curtin made 29 saves on 31 shots in the two tournament games and recorded a 1.00 goals agianst average. German had two assists and was plus-3 in the two tournament games, while Gutt had a goal in each tourney game and went 21-of-27 on face-offs. Hughes led Utica with four points on three goals and an assist in the two UCHC Tournament contests. He had two goals and an assist against Nazareth and added a key insurance goal against Geneseo.
Defenseman Dakota Zarudny and forward Filip Wiberg of runner-up SUNY Geneseo were also named to the All-Tournament Team. Zarudny had a goal and an assist and was plus-3 in the 7-5 semifinal win over Chatham, while Wiberg, the 2025 UCHC Championship Most Valuable Player, scored Geneseo's goal in the championship game, added two assists in the semifinal win over Chatham and won 33 face-offs in the two games.

ABOUT THE UNITED COLLEGIATE HOCKEY CONFERENCE
The United Collegiate Hockey Conference is a collaborative effort to provide a competitive environment and structure for NCAA Division III men's and women's ice hockey in the Eastern United States. The UCHC will enter its eighth season in 2024-25 with first-year members SUNY Brockport and SUNY Geneseo joining founding members Chatham University, Manhattanville University, Nazareth University and Utica University.
